The death toll from the volcanic eruption in New Zealand has risen to 17.
Police say the latest victim died in hospital in Auckland on Sunday.
Meanwhile, two people remain missing - authorities believe they were swept out to sea.
There were 47 people, mainly Australian tourists, on White Island when it erupted on December 9.
As may as 25 people are in hospital, with many in a critical condition.
